Output 2db203ecfdb5ca695bda2e58a2964a96f0439f0fc806ffc7ae86fb6f7a4eafd7:1

value
391642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44bfc399d810008f4b4056384fc56621a30fcb8e OP_EQUAL
address
37xXbb85nVToEYEFzn8odBgS8fxPb1vufa
transaction
2db203ecfdb5ca695bda2e58a2964a96f0439f0fc806ffc7ae86fb6f7a4eafd7
confirmations
453610
spent
true